"Reach Out" is a song from Take That's fourth album, Beautiful World, released as the album's fourth single on 22 June 2007. Reach Out was released exclusively in Europe , as an alternative to the British-only single " I'd Wait for Life ".
"Reach Out" is a song recorded by American singer Hilary Duff from her first greatest hits album Best of Hilary Duff (2008). It was released on October 27, 2008, by Hollywood Records as the only single from the album. The song was initially recorded for inclusion on a scrapped re-release of Duff's fourth studio album Dignity (2007). [1]

"Reach Out" is a song by American rock band Cheap Trick, released in 1981 as a single from the soundtrack of the 1981 film Heavy Metal. It was written by Bob James and Pete Comita , and produced by Roy Thomas Baker .
